在AI语音开放平台上实现语音风格迁移的方法
在人工智能技术飞速发展的今天,语音识别和语音合成技术已经取得了显著的成果。其中,语音风格迁移技术作为语音合成领域的一个重要分支,引起了广泛关注。本文将介绍一种在AI语音开放平台上实现语音风格迁移的方法,并讲述一个关于该技术的应用故事。
一、语音风格迁移技术概述
语音风格迁移技术是指将一种语音的说话风格迁移到另一种语音上,使得合成语音听起来更加自然、真实。该技术可以应用于电影、电视剧、游戏、直播等领域,为用户提供更加丰富的语音体验。
二、语音风格迁移方法
- 数据准备
首先,我们需要收集大量的语音数据,包括不同说话人的语音以及具有不同风格的语音。这些数据可以来自公开的语音数据集或自建的语音数据集。
- 风格表示
为了实现语音风格迁移,我们需要对语音风格进行有效的表示。一种常用的方法是使用隐层表示(Latent Representation),即通过神经网络提取语音数据的潜在特征。这些潜在特征可以表示语音的说话风格。
- 风格迁移模型
基于上述风格表示,我们可以构建一个风格迁移模型。该模型主要由两个部分组成:编码器和解码器。
(1)编码器:将源语音的潜在特征转换为风格特征。编码器通常采用卷积神经网络(CNN)或循环神经网络(RNN)等深度学习模型。
(2)解码器:将风格特征与目标语音的潜在特征进行融合,生成具有目标风格的合成语音。解码器同样可以采用CNN或RNN等模型。
- 训练与优化
在训练过程中,我们需要使用大量的语音数据对模型进行训练。通过优化损失函数,使得模型能够更好地学习语音风格。常见的损失函数包括均方误差(MSE)和感知损失(Perceptual Loss)等。
三、应用案例
某知名游戏公司为了提升游戏体验,希望通过语音风格迁移技术为游戏角色赋予独特的说话风格。该公司收集了大量游戏角色的语音数据,并利用本文介绍的语音风格迁移方法,将游戏角色的说话风格迁移到其他角色上。
具体操作如下:
数据准备:收集游戏角色的语音数据,包括源角色和目标角色的语音。
风格表示:使用预训练的语音识别模型提取源角色和目标角色的潜在特征。
风格迁移模型:构建风格迁移模型,将源角色的潜在特征转换为风格特征,并融合目标角色的潜在特征。
训练与优化:使用收集到的语音数据对模型进行训练,优化损失函数。
应用:将训练好的模型应用于游戏角色,为游戏角色赋予独特的说话风格。
通过应用语音风格迁移技术,游戏角色的说话风格更加丰富多样,为玩家带来了更加沉浸式的游戏体验。此外,该方法还可以应用于其他领域,如电影、电视剧、直播等,为用户提供更加个性化的语音体验。
四、总结
本文介绍了一种在AI语音开放平台上实现语音风格迁移的方法,并讲述了一个关于该技术的应用故事。该方法通过构建风格迁移模型,将源语音的说话风格迁移到目标语音上,为用户提供更加丰富的语音体验。随着人工智能技术的不断发展,语音风格迁移技术将在更多领域得到应用,为人们的生活带来更多便利。
猜你喜欢:deepseek智能对话